INDIA
FURTHER CONTRIBUTIONS. RECRUITNIG PROCEEDING SATISFACTORILY. Delhi, August 26. The recent Baltic successes were received with the utmost enthusiasm in India. The. manufacture of munitions is progressing. Two factories have been established in Calcutta. All communi-; ties are giving valuable assistance. The Indian nobles continue their generosity, the Maharajah of Tiotak giving 25,000 rupees for comforts fcr the 42ml Delhi Regiment, of which he is an honorary colonel. The Rajah of Dewas has given £ 1000, the Regency of 11ahawalpnr £IOOO, the Tialsia ' Durbar .€I3OO for the purchase of motor ambulances, (lie Maharaja and Rana of Cholpur a motor-car, the Mir of Khairpur a military aeroplane, the Maharajah of Tipperah a motor launch for Mesopotamia. Gifts of all kinds continue to lie given to the ambulance branches throughout India. Recruiting continues briskly. ,
